Murder or not? Apparently several home-made abortions
Advertisements [?]
"OCEAN CITY (AP/WBOC) - Ocean City police say they have found the infant remains at the home of a mother who was charged last week with the murder of a small baby.

Police say they found a garbage bag hidden within a trunk in Christy Freeman's bedroom. According to police, inside the garbage bag were three smaller plastic bags; two contained infant human remains, and the other contained what investigators believe to be a placenta."

"...the investigation began Thursday when social workers called police from the local hospital to report that Christy Freeman, 37, had been pregnant but couldn't account for the whereabouts of her child."

"Police say they're not sure if any of the newly discovered babies were full-term or carried by Freeman. They have used the state's "viable fetus" law to charge Freeman with murder in the death of the infant who was found inside the blanket."
